Quote from: jenfry;546909
I'm trying to install a 20GB hard drive on a 1200 with accelerator board; I have 3.0 kickstart and I'm trying to use FastROMAtaPatch for the scsi.device and fixhdsize, but the maximum amout is always 8GB!! :(
What can I do??

The answer is in the posts above.

Run IDEFIX, it contains a number of patches to Scsi.device that are sessential, and run a better File system than FFS, like SPS or something.

I have a 20GIG in my A1200.

But AFAIK, Workbench 3.9+ you do not need IDEFIX.  BUT !!!!!!!!!!, to install 3.9, you need a CDROM, to access the disk, and since you do not get those drivers from the CDROM until you have a cdrom drive working.... hmmmm..

Use IDEFIX, install 3.9, delete IDEFIX.  but as you have kickstart 3.0, you are running Workbench 3.0/3.1 yes ?, IDEfix for you my buddy.

Quote from: jenfry;546915
Buf IDEfix is free? I found idefix97.lha, is the one you are talking about?

IDEFIX is not free, you can 'Register it' through Vesalia, but it is FULLY functional in its downloadable state, yes IDEFix97 from Aminet. Check the docs.

[edit] from Readme file.

"Restrictions of unregistered version: Nag requesters, otherwise fully functional."
